What is Windows 93 and what does it consist of?
Windows 93 is a parody of Windows 95 created by Jakenpopp and Zombectro , a group of French developers who managed to create this recreation of the mythical Microsoft operating system written in HTML5 and Java which can be executed in any browser that is compatible with this technology .
Windows 93 Features And A Bit Of Everything
This operating system is built under Java and HTML5 and can be run from any browser compatible with this technology . We must know that despite not being an operating system as such, it has really interesting functions such as:
- Nintendo, MS-DOS , Game Boy or NES emulators .
- Text editors.
- Your own browser.
- Several games like solitaire or minesweeper.

Playing Wolfenstein 3D
The system brings really interesting options such as being able to run the mythical Wolfestein 3D or even run MS-DOS games like Doom , Alone in the Dark or Abuse , thanks to the Dos-Box emulator incorporated in the Windows 93 “ISO”.
